Inshore fishing and flats fishing trips are done in water less than 5 feet deep along the grassy flat or mangrove shoreline where it generally remains calm on even the windiest of days. This makes a great trip for those who worry about getting seasick or have smaller children. All tackle, bait, and fishing licenses are included. All ages are welcome. Yes, it is possible to catch big fish in shallow water. Commonly caught species include Redfish, Snook, Flounder, Seatrout, Sheepshead, Mangrove Snapper, Cobia, Spanish Mackeral, shallow water Grouper, and small Sharks using live bait, plastics, and cut bait. What types of fishing charters are common in Spring Hill?

Deep Sea fishing is the most popular in Spring Hill as well as inshore fishing, flats fishing, and nearshore fishing.

The most commonly sought after species in Spring Hill are: 1. redfish, 2. speckled trout, 3. snook, and 4. mangrove snapper.

The most common fishing techniques in Spring Hill are light tackle fishing, live bait fishing, and bottom fishing but artificial lure fishing and cut bait fishing are popular as well.

Do I need a Spring Hill fishing license and what are the bag limits in Spring Hill?

If you’re thinking about a saltwater trip, you’re in luck! Our saltwater fishing tours in Spring Hill don’t require you to purchase a fishing license – your group is covered by your boat’s captain. For freshwater trips, you’ll still need to purchase a license. See here for more information on fishing licenses, bag limits, and fishing season regulations in Spring Hill. When in doubt, your fishing guide will always know the right rules and regulations.

What are the best places to fish in Spring Hill?

Spring Hill, Florida, offers anglers a variety of prime fishing spots to explore, each with its own unique appeal and opportunities. One standout location is Weeki Wachee Springs State Park, renowned for its crystal-clear waters and abundant freshwater species. Anglers can cast their lines from the park's designated fishing areas along the Weeki Wachee River, targeting species such as bass, bluegill, and catfish amidst the scenic beauty of the park's natural surroundings.

Another popular fishing destination in Spring Hill is Hunters Lake, a picturesque freshwater lake known for its excellent bass fishing. Anglers can explore the lake's tranquil waters by boat or kayak, searching for largemouth bass lurking amidst the submerged structures and vegetation. With its abundant cover and ample forage, Hunters Lake provides anglers with ample opportunities to reel in trophy-sized bass and enjoy a memorable day on the water.

Other things to do in Spring Hill

In addition to its fantastic fishing opportunities, Spring Hill, Florida, offers visitors a wealth of activities to enjoy during their stay. Nature enthusiasts can explore the breathtaking beauty of nearby parks and wildlife areas, such as the Weeki Wachee Springs State Park. This scenic park features hiking trails, picnic areas, and opportunities for wildlife viewing amidst its lush forests and along the banks of the Weeki Wachee River. Visitors can also enjoy a unique experience by attending one of the famous mermaid shows at the park's underwater theater.

History buffs will appreciate the chance to delve into the area's rich cultural heritage at sites like the Hernando Heritage Museum. This museum showcases artifacts and exhibits detailing the history and culture of Spring Hill and the surrounding area, offering visitors a fascinating glimpse into the region's past. Additionally, nearby attractions such as the Tampa Bay Automobile Museum provide insight into the evolution of automotive technology, with displays of vintage cars and classic automobiles that are sure to captivate visitors of all ages.

For those seeking outdoor adventure, Spring Hill is just a short drive away from the stunning beaches and recreational opportunities of the Gulf Coast. Visitors can spend their days sunbathing, swimming, or beachcombing along the pristine shoreline of nearby beaches like Pine Island or Hernando Beach. Watersports enthusiasts can try their hand at activities like kayaking, paddleboarding, or snorkeling, while those looking for relaxation can simply unwind and soak in the coastal vibes.
